图形管理工具 em
服务器端
1 保证侦听启动----->grid
lsnrctl status
或者
netstat -tunlp |grep 1521
如果没有起来
lsnrctl start
2 保证数据库启动---->oracle
sqlplus / as sysdba
如果没有启动
shutdown abort ;
startup ;
3 保证em这个工具启用--->oracle
[[email protected] ~]$ emctl status dbconsole
默认端口1158
或者通过端口看
[[email protected] ~]$ netstat -tunlp |grep 1158
如果没有启动
emctl stop dbconsole
emctl start dbconsole
客户端就可以通过浏览器访问(建议用google浏览器)
https://数据库服务器名或者ip:1158/em
https://192.168.2.1:1158/em
点仍然继续
我们需要英文
点设置->点高级设置->点语言和输入设置->点添加->到最后点英文-English->点住上移到最上面
点击完成
然后刷新页面
谁可以登录: 只有sys system用户
* User Name sys
* Password oracle
Connect As sysdba
查看那些人可以登录em
要求:用em建立一个账户web_admin 给予dba的权限 可以通过em管理数据库
sys登录em
Server--->Security-->Users
点创建
账户名web_admin
密码 oracle
Roles---->editlist --->dba角色
System Privileges---》editlist
sysdba角色--->ok
你可以点击show sql 看到你刚才点击相对应的SQL语句
最后点ok
把该账户加入到em的管理员
右上角----》setup --->administrators --->create
Name 勾选web_admin
权限: super administrator
finish 结束
要求:用web_admin登录,建立一个表xs (id number ,name char(10))
logout ---->login --
>输入用户名web_admin 密码 oracle
Schema--->tables --->create
输入表名
输入列名 选择数据类型
点show sql
ok